Given Input Data is 572, 957, 182, 852
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 572 is 2 x 2 x 11 x 13
Prime Factorization of 957 is 3 x 11 x 29
Prime Factorization of 182 is 2 x 7 x 13
Prime Factorization of 852 is 2 x 2 x 3 x 71
The above numbers do not have any common prime factor. So GCD is 1
Step1:
Let's calculate the GCD of first two numbers
The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)
LCM(572, 957) = 49764
GCD(572, 957) = ( 572 x 957 ) / 49764
GCD(572, 957) = 547404 / 49764
GCD(572, 957) = 11
Step2:
Here we consider the GCD from the above i.e. 11 as first number and the next as 182
The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)
LCM(11, 182) = 2002
GCD(11, 182) = ( 11 x 182 ) / 2002
GCD(11, 182) = 2002 / 2002
GCD(11, 182) = 1
Step3:
Here we consider the GCD from the above i.e. 1 as first number and the next as 852
The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)
LCM(1, 852) = 852
GCD(1, 852) = ( 1 x 852 ) / 852
GCD(1, 852) = 852 / 852
GCD(1, 852) = 1
GCD of 572, 957, 182, 852 is 1
